Funktionen MAKEARRAY

Gælder for
Excel til Microsoft 365 Excel til Microsoft 365 til Mac

Returnerer en beregnet matrix med en angivet række- og kolonnestørrelse ved at anvende en LAMBDA-funktion.

Syntaks

=MAKEARRAY(rækker, kolonner; lambda(række, kolonne))

Syntaksen for funktionen MAKEARRAY har følgende argumenter og parametre:

  • Rækker Antallet af rækker i matrixen. Skal være større end nul.

  • kolonner Antallet af kolonner i matrixen. Skal være større end nul.

  • Lambda En LAMBDA, der kaldes for at oprette matrixen. LAMBDA tager to parametre:

    • Række Rækkeindekset for matrixen.
    • Oberst Kolonneindekset for matrixen.

Fejl

Hvis du angiver en ugyldig LAMBDA-funktion eller et forkert antal parametre, returneres en #VÆRDI! fejl kaldet "Forkerte Parametre".

Hvis du angiver et række- eller kolonneargument til en værdi < 1 eller til et ikke-tal, returneres en #VALUE! som fejl.

Eksempler

Eksempel 1: Opret en 2D-matrix, der repræsenterer en simpel multiplikationstabel

Kopiér følgende formel til celle C2:

=MAKEARRAY(3,3,LAMBDA(r,c,r*c))

Første MAKEARRAY-funktion, eksempel1

Eksempel: 2: Opret en tilfældig liste over værdier

Indtast eksempeldataene i cellerne D1:E3, og kopiér derefter formlen til celle D4:

=MAKEARRAY(D2,E2,LAMBDA(row,col,CHOOSE(RANDBETWEEN(1,3),"Red","Blue","Green")))

Anden MAKEARRAY-funktion, eksempel1